Central Agricultural University Hires Project Assistant in Imphal

Imphal: Central Agricultural University in Imphal is looking for a Project Assistant. The role is a contractual position. It falls under an ANRF-PMECRG funded project focused on the design and development of a continuous two-stage frying system for making healthy snacks.

Applicants need a first-class degree in Food Technology, Food Engineering, or Agricultural Engineering. Holding an M.Tech with NET or GATE qualification is a bonus, as is previous research experience in machine design.

Candidates must show up for a walk-in interview on July 22, 2026. The session happens at the Conference Hall, College of Food Technology, CAU, Lamphelpat. Interviews start at 10.00 am, but reporting starts at 9 am.

Bring a typed application with two passport-sized photos. You must also carry original documents, marksheets, and self-attested photocopies. The university described the research focus as the "Design and development of a continuous two-stage frying system for the production of healthy savoury snacks in the food industries."
